Discover the Link Between Ozempic and Tinnitus

If you are taking Ozempic, a medication commonly used to treat type 2 diabetes, you may already be familiar with some of its potential side effects. However, one side effect that is not commonly talked about but has been reported by some users is tinnitus. Tinnitus is a condition characterized by ringing, buzzing, or other noises in the ears without an external source. While the exact connection between Ozempic and tinnitus is not fully understood, it is believed that the medication may affect the inner ear or auditory nerves, leading to this bothersome symptom.

It is important to be aware of the potential risks associated with taking Ozempic, including the development of tinnitus. If you are experiencing this side effect or any other concerning symptoms while taking Ozempic, it is crucial to speak with your healthcare provider immediately.
